Engine Running Stand Wiring Diagram

Text by George Bryan, diagram by George Bryan and Joe Leoni

I realized making a fast on the floor hook up to test out an engine was not rocket science; but I could never find a good "how to" diagram that had an "in car" type set up. I designed one that uses all 356 components, and I am building it now out of an old trans case, small gas tank, etc. Using this diagram, a person can set up an engine to run on the floor that will test out gauges, switch, generator, senders, volt regulator, starter and other components. Much easier to run one of these, test things out, adjust carbs etc, before you go into the car.
